In the 12th episode of our third season, we dive into the world of true crime and forensics.
From cases seen over the media to much smaller ones, True crime is everywhere, and so are the forensics scientists that work on the cases.
If these cases truly are as frequent as they seem, what really goes on behind the scenes, and how large is the forensics field going to get?
In this episode hosts Thomas Bacchus and Hailey Patterson discuss with forensics teacher Mrs. Brun, how forensic science skills help in the field, and the growing interest in learning about true crime.
